        public static Tuple <EntityBufType, bool> GetTypeBufType(Type tp)
        {
            if (tp == null)
            {
                return(null);
            }
            int key = tp.GetHashCode();

            if (TypeBufTypeDic.ContainsKey(key))
            {
                return(TypeBufTypeDic[key]);
            }
            else
            {
                try
                {
                    TypeBufTypeDicLockSlim.EnterWriteLock();
                    bool          isArray;
                    EntityBufType objType = MapBufType(tp, out isArray);
                    Tuple <EntityBufType, bool> touple = new Tuple <EntityBufType, bool>(objType, isArray);
                    try
                    {
                        TypeBufTypeDic.Add(key, touple);
                    }
                    catch
                    {
                    }
                    return(touple);
                }
                finally
                {
                    TypeBufTypeDicLockSlim.ExitWriteLock();
                }
            }
        }

        private static object DeserializeSimple(EntityBufType buftype, bool isArray, MemoryStreamReader msReader)
        {
            if (buftype.EntityType == EntityType.COMPLEX)
            {
                throw new EntityBufException("无法反序列化复杂类型");
            }

            if (buftype.EntityType == EntityType.UNKNOWN)
            {
                throw new EntityBufException("无法反序列化未知类型");
            }

            switch (buftype.EntityType)
            {
            case EntityType.BYTE:
                if (isArray)
                {
                    return(msReader.ReadByteArray());
                }
                else
                {
                    return(msReader.ReadByte());
                }

            case EntityType.STRING:
                if (isArray)
                {
                    return(msReader.ReadStringArray());
                }
                else
                {
                    return(msReader.ReadString());
                }

            case EntityType.CHAR:
                if (isArray)
                {
                    return(msReader.ReadCharArray());
                }
                else
                {
                    return(msReader.ReadChar());
                }

            case EntityType.SHORT:
            case EntityType.INT16:
                if (isArray)
                {
                    return(msReader.ReadInt16Array());
                }
                else
                {
                    return(msReader.ReadInt16());
                }

            case EntityType.USHORT:
                if (isArray)
                {
                    return(msReader.ReadUInt16Array());
                }
                else
                {
                    return(msReader.ReadUInt16());
                }

            case EntityType.INT32:
                if (isArray)
                {
                    return(msReader.ReadInt32Array());
                }
                else
                {
                    return(msReader.ReadInt32());
                }

            case EntityType.INT64:
                if (isArray)
                {
                    return(msReader.ReadInt64Array());
                }
                else
                {
                    return(msReader.ReadInt64());
                }

            case EntityType.DOUBLE:
                if (isArray)
                {
                    return(msReader.ReadDoubleArray());
                }
                else
                {
                    return(msReader.ReadDouble());
                }

            case EntityType.FLOAT:
                if (isArray)
                {
                    return(msReader.ReadFloatArray());
                }
                else
                {
                    return(msReader.ReadFloat());
                }

            case EntityType.DECIMAL:
                if (isArray)
                {
                    return(msReader.ReadDeciamlArray());
                }
                else
                {
                    return(msReader.ReadDecimal());
                }

            case EntityType.DATETIME:
                if (isArray)
                {
                    return(msReader.ReadDateTimeArray());
                }
                else
                {
                    return(msReader.ReadDateTime());
                }

            case EntityType.BOOL:
                if (isArray)
                {
                    return(msReader.ReadBoolArray());
                }
                else
                {
                    return(msReader.ReadBool());
                }

            case EntityType.ENUM:
                if (isArray)
                {
                    string[] strarray = msReader.ReadStringArray();
                    Array    arr      = (Array)Activator.CreateInstance(buftype.ValueType, strarray.Length);
                    for (int i = 0; i < strarray.Length; i++)
                    {
                        arr.SetValue(Enum.Parse(buftype.ClassType, strarray[i]), i);
                    }
                    return(arr);
                }
                else
                {
                    return(Enum.Parse(buftype.ClassType, msReader.ReadString()));
                }

            case EntityType.DICTIONARY:
                if (isArray)
                {
                    int arrlen = msReader.ReadInt32();
                    if (arrlen == -1)
                    {
                        return(null);
                    }

                    var dicarr = (Array)Activator.CreateInstance(buftype.ValueType, arrlen);
                    for (int i = 0; i < arrlen; i++)
                    {
                        dicarr.SetValue(DeSerialize(buftype.ClassType, msReader), i);
                    }

                    return(dicarr);
                }
                else
                {
                    int dicLen = msReader.ReadInt32();
                    if (dicLen == -1)
                    {
                        return(null);
                    }

                    System.Collections.IDictionary idic = (System.Collections.IDictionary)Activator.CreateInstance(buftype.ValueType);
                    var keyvaluetype = GetDirctionaryKeyValueType(buftype.ValueType);

                    for (int i = 0; i < dicLen; i++)
                    {
                        idic.Add(DeSerialize(keyvaluetype[0], msReader), DeSerialize(keyvaluetype[1], msReader));
                    }

                    return(idic);
                }

            case EntityType.LIST:
                if (isArray)
                {
                    var listarrlen = msReader.ReadInt32();
                    if (listarrlen == -1)
                    {
                        return(null);
                    }
                    var listArray = (Array)Activator.CreateInstance(buftype.ValueType, listarrlen);
                    for (int i = 0; i < listarrlen; i++)
                    {
                        listArray.SetValue(DeSerialize(buftype.ClassType, msReader), i);
                    }
                    return(listArray);
                }
                else
                {
                    var listlen = msReader.ReadInt32();
                    if (listlen == -1)
                    {
                        return(null);
                    }
                    var list          = (System.Collections.IList)Activator.CreateInstance(buftype.ValueType);
                    var listvaluetype = GetListValueType(buftype.ValueType);
                    for (int i = 0; i < listlen; i++)
                    {
                        list.Add(DeSerialize(listvaluetype, msReader));
                    }
                    return(list);
                }

            case EntityType.ARRAY:
                if (isArray)
                {
                    var listarrlen = msReader.ReadInt32();
                    if (listarrlen == -1)
                    {
                        return(null);
                    }
                    var listArray = (Array)Activator.CreateInstance(buftype.ValueType, listarrlen);
                    for (int i = 0; i < listarrlen; i++)
                    {
                        listArray.SetValue(DeSerialize(buftype.ClassType, msReader), i);
                    }
                    return(listArray);
                }
                else
                {
                    var arrlen = msReader.ReadInt32();
                    if (arrlen == -1)
                    {
                        return(null);
                    }
                    var arr           = (Array)Activator.CreateInstance(buftype.ValueType, arrlen);
                    var listvaluetype = GetListValueType(buftype.ValueType);
                    for (int i = 0; i < arrlen; i++)
                    {
                        arr.SetValue(DeSerialize(listvaluetype, msReader), i);
                    }
                    return(arr);
                }

            default:
                throw new EntityBufException("反序列化错误");
            }
        }

        private static void SerializeSimple(object val, bool isArray, EntityBufType bufType, MemoryStreamWriter msWriter)
        {
            //if (bufType.EntityType == EntityType.COMPLEX)
            //{
            //    throw new Exception("无法序列化复杂类型");
            //}

            switch (bufType.EntityType)
            {
            case EntityType.BYTE:
                if (isArray)
                {
                    msWriter.WriteByteArray((byte[])val);
                }
                else
                {
                    msWriter.WriteByte((byte)val);
                }
                break;

            case EntityType.STRING:
                if (isArray)
                {
                    msWriter.WriteStringArray((string[])val);
                }
                else
                {
                    msWriter.WriteString((string)val);
                }
                break;

            case EntityType.SHORT:
            case EntityType.INT16:
                if (isArray)
                {
                    msWriter.WriteInt16Array((Int16[])val);
                }
                else
                {
                    msWriter.WriteInt16((Int16)val);
                }
                break;

            case EntityType.USHORT:
                if (isArray)
                {
                    msWriter.WriteUInt16Array((UInt16[])val);
                }
                else
                {
                    msWriter.WriteUInt16((UInt16)val);
                }
                break;

            case EntityType.INT32:
                if (isArray)
                {
                    msWriter.WriteInt32Array((Int32[])val);
                }
                else
                {
                    msWriter.WriteInt32((Int32)val);
                }
                break;

            case EntityType.CHAR:
                if (isArray)
                {
                    msWriter.WriteCharArray((char[])val);
                }
                else
                {
                    msWriter.WriteChar((char)val);
                }
                break;

            case EntityType.DECIMAL:
                if (isArray)
                {
                    msWriter.WriteDeciamlArray((decimal[])val);
                }
                else
                {
                    msWriter.WriteDecimal((decimal)val);
                }
                break;

            case EntityType.DOUBLE:
                if (isArray)
                {
                    msWriter.WriteDoubleArray((double[])val);
                }
                else
                {
                    msWriter.WriteDouble((double)val);
                }
                break;

            case EntityType.FLOAT:
                if (isArray)
                {
                    msWriter.WriteFloatArray((float[])val);
                }
                else
                {
                    msWriter.WriteFloat((float)val);
                }
                break;

            case EntityType.INT64:
                if (isArray)
                {
                    msWriter.WriteInt64Array((Int64[])val);
                }
                else
                {
                    msWriter.WriteInt64((Int64)val);
                }
                break;

            case EntityType.DATETIME:
                if (isArray)
                {
                    msWriter.WriteDateTimeArray((DateTime[])val);
                }
                else
                {
                    msWriter.WriteDateTime((DateTime)val);
                }
                break;

            case EntityType.BOOL:
                if (isArray)
                {
                    msWriter.WriteBoolArray((bool[])val);
                }
                else
                {
                    msWriter.WriteBool((bool)val);
                }
                break;

            case EntityType.ENUM:
                if (isArray)
                {
                    Array    arr    = (Array)val;
                    string[] strarr = new string[arr.Length];
                    for (int i = 0; i < arr.Length; i++)
                    {
                        strarr[i] = arr.GetValue(i).ToString();
                    }
                    msWriter.WriteStringArray(strarr);
                }
                else
                {
                    msWriter.WriteString(val.ToString());
                }
                break;

            case EntityType.DICTIONARY:
                if (isArray)
                {
                    if (val == null)
                    {
                        msWriter.WriteInt32(-1);
                        break;
                    }
                    var dicArray = (Array)val;
                    msWriter.WriteInt32(dicArray.Length);
                    for (int i = 0; i < dicArray.Length; i++)
                    {
                        Serialize(dicArray.GetValue(i), msWriter);
                    }
                }
                else
                {
                    if (val == null)
                    {
                        msWriter.WriteInt32(-1);
                        break;
                    }
                    System.Collections.IDictionary idic = (System.Collections.IDictionary)val;
                    //写入长度
                    msWriter.WriteInt32(idic.Count);
                    int i = 0;
                    foreach (var kv in idic)
                    {
                        object k = kv.Eval("Key");
                        object v = kv.Eval("Value");

                        Serialize(k, msWriter);
                        Serialize(v, msWriter);
                        i++;
                    }
                }
                break;

            case EntityType.LIST:
                if (isArray)
                {
                    if (val == null)
                    {
                        msWriter.WriteInt32(-1);
                        break;
                    }
                    var listarr = (Array)val;
                    msWriter.WriteInt32(listarr.Length);
                    for (int i = 0; i < listarr.Length; i++)
                    {
                        Serialize(listarr.GetValue(i), msWriter);
                    }
                }
                else
                {
                    if (val == null)
                    {
                        msWriter.WriteInt32(-1);
                        break;
                    }
                    var list = (System.Collections.IList)val;
                    msWriter.WriteInt32(list.Count);
                    foreach (var item in list)
                    {
                        Serialize(item, msWriter);
                    }
                }
                break;

            case EntityType.ARRAY:
                if (isArray)
                {
                    if (val == null)
                    {
                        msWriter.WriteInt32(-1);
                        break;
                    }
                    var listarr = (Array)val;
                    msWriter.WriteInt32(listarr.Length);
                    for (int i = 0; i < listarr.Length; i++)
                    {
                        Serialize(listarr.GetValue(i), msWriter);
                    }
                }
                else
                {
                    if (val == null)
                    {
                        msWriter.WriteInt32(-1);
                        break;
                    }
                    var arr = (Array)val;
                    msWriter.WriteInt32(arr.Length);
                    foreach (var item in arr)
                    {
                        Serialize(item, msWriter);
                    }
                }
                break;

            default:
                throw new EntityBufException("序列化错误");
            }
        }

        private static EntityBufType MapBufType(Type type, out bool isArray)
        {
            EntityBufType ebtype = new EntityBufType();

            ebtype.ValueType = type;

            if (type.IsArray)
            //if (type.Name.EndsWith("[]"))
            {
                isArray = true;
                string typefullname = string.Format("{0}, {1}", type.FullName.Substring(0, type.FullName.LastIndexOf('[')),
                                                    type.Assembly.FullName);
                ebtype.ClassType = Type.GetType(typefullname);
            }
            else
            {
                isArray          = false;
                ebtype.ClassType = type;
            }

            string typename = ebtype.ClassType.Name;

            switch (typename)
            {
            case "Short":
                ebtype.EntityType   = EntityType.SHORT;
                ebtype.DefaultValue = default(short);
                break;

            case "UInt16":
            case "Ushort":
                ebtype.EntityType   = EntityType.USHORT;
                ebtype.DefaultValue = default(ushort);
                break;

            case "Int16":
                ebtype.EntityType   = EntityType.INT16;
                ebtype.DefaultValue = default(Int16);
                break;

            case "Int32":
                ebtype.EntityType   = EntityType.INT32;
                ebtype.DefaultValue = default(Int16);
                break;

            case "Long":
            case "Int64":
                ebtype.EntityType   = EntityType.INT64;
                ebtype.DefaultValue = default(Int64);
                break;

            case "Byte":
                ebtype.EntityType   = EntityType.BYTE;
                ebtype.DefaultValue = default(byte);
                break;

            case "Char":
                ebtype.EntityType   = EntityType.CHAR;
                ebtype.DefaultValue = default(char);
                break;

            case "Double":
                ebtype.EntityType   = EntityType.DOUBLE;
                ebtype.DefaultValue = default(double);
                break;

            case "Float":
                ebtype.EntityType   = EntityType.FLOAT;
                ebtype.DefaultValue = default(float);
                break;

            case "String":
                ebtype.EntityType   = EntityType.STRING;
                ebtype.DefaultValue = default(string);
                break;

            case "DateTime":
                ebtype.EntityType = EntityType.DATETIME;
                break;

            case "Decimal":
                ebtype.EntityType   = EntityType.DECIMAL;
                ebtype.DefaultValue = default(decimal);
                break;

            case "Boolean":
                ebtype.EntityType   = EntityType.BOOL;
                ebtype.DefaultValue = default(bool);
                break;

            case "Dictionary`2":
                ebtype.EntityType = EntityType.DICTIONARY;
                ebtype.GenerTypes = GetDirctionaryKeyValueType(ebtype.ValueType);
                break;

            case "List`1":
                ebtype.EntityType = EntityType.LIST;
                break;

            default:
                if (isArray)
                {
                    ebtype.EntityType = EntityType.ARRAY;
                }
                else if (ebtype.ClassType.IsEnum)
                {
                    ebtype.EntityType = EntityType.ENUM;
                }
                else if (ebtype.ClassType.IsClass)
                {
                    ebtype.EntityType = EntityType.COMPLEX;
                }
                break;
            }

            return(ebtype);
        }
